def _get_file_not_found_error(file_path):
|
||||
"""Return a helpful error message when a library file can't be found."""
|
||||
active_server = config_manager.get_active_media_server()
|
||||
if active_server == 'navidrome':
|
||||
# Check if path looks like a Navidrome fake path (no real filesystem root)
|
||||
# Fake paths look like: "Artist/Album/01 - Track.flac" or just "Track.flac"
|
||||
if file_path and ('/' not in file_path or not file_path.startswith('/')):
|
||||
return ('File not found — Navidrome may be sending virtual paths. '
|
||||
'Go to Navidrome → Profile → Players → select SoulSync → enable "Report Real Path", '
|
||||
'then run a full database refresh in SoulSync.')
|
||||
return ('File not found on disk — check that your Navidrome music folder '
|
||||
'is mounted in the SoulSync container and that "Report Real Path" is enabled '
|
||||
'in Navidrome\'s player settings.')
|
||||
return 'File not found on disk'
